CATEGORY 24 HERALDRY, COINS, EMBLEMS, SYMBOLS
24.1.

SHIELDS

24.3.

SEALS, STAMPS

24.5.

MEDALS, COINS, DECORATIONS, ORDERS

24.7.

FLAGS

24.9.

CROWNS, DIADEMS

24.11.

EMBLEMS, INSIGNIA

24.13.

CROSSES

24.15.

ARROWS

24.17.

SIGNS, NOTATIONS, SYMBOLS

 24.11

EMBLEMS, INSIGNIA

 24.11.1

Roman ensigns, lictors’ fasces, sceptres

 24.11.3

Staves with wings (Mercury’s staff)

 24.11.5

Pastoral staffs, shepherds’ crooks

 24.11.7

Neptune’s tridents

 24.11.11

Globes surmounted by a cross

 24.11.13

Mitres

 24.11.14

Mercury’s helmet (with wings)

 24.11.15

Star of David

 24.11.16

Horns of plenty

 24.11.17

Chinese symbol of good luck (Ruyi)

 24.11.18

Signs, drawings or other figurative elements recognized as emblems or insignia

 24.11.21

Braid (as decoration of honour or rank), cockades

 
Note: Not including chevrons, which are placed in the same section as angles (26.3.23).
 24.11.25

Other emblems or insignia

 
Note: (a) Including evil eye.
 (b) Not including representations of the serpent and cup (3.11.1), the serpent and staff (3.11.1), imperial eagles (3.7.1) and torches (13.1.5).
